5 Size of expansion vessel
For the system water expansion to be contained by the
6
litre
expansion vessel the cold system volume must not exceed:
96 litres when pressurised to 0.5 bar (cold)
88 litres when pressurised to 0.7 bar (cold)
81 litres when pressurised to 1.0 bar (cold)
If the pressure exceeds 2.65 bar when the boiler is up to
temperature with all radiators in use then an additional
expansion vessel MUST be installed on the return pipework.
For expansion volumes see Table 5.
Guidance on vessel sizing is given in BS 7074:1 and BS 5449
For IE refer to the current edition of I.S. 813.

7 Draining the system
Draining taps MUST be located in accessible positions to
permit the draining of the whole central heating system,
including the central heating side of the boiler. The taps
should be at least 1/2” BSP nominal size and be in
accordance with BS 2879.
